DURHAM, N.C. — Durham Police said they are investigating the report of a bomb threat in Durham.
The reported threat is in the vicinity of 1937 West Cornwallis Road.
According to the Durham Watch Commander, there was an initial scene on Cornwallis Road; however, as of 7:15 a.m., the scene was cleared.
He was unable to provide a more specific location, as he said there were various locations involved, including the Levin Jewish Community Center.
He said he believes this is related to an old threat, but there is very limited information.
